The sun has finally graced us with its presence, and I have four words that will make your weekend even brighter: Crystalyn Kae handbag sale. The renowned local designer is celebrating her tenth year in the handbag biz with an exclusive sale on vegan hobo bags and clutches (like the happy Soiree bag above) at her studio this Saturday from 10 a.m. – 4 p.m. Grab an iced drink, head to Phinney Ridge and look for the balloons at 5611 Phinney Ave N; more details here.
